Reading over comments about the Washington Nationals over-use of the bullpen, it just is not factually true as the Nationals have the 3rd lowest usage of the bullpen at 3.0 innings per game. The only teams that are less are the Astros and the Cleveland Indians at 2.8 and 2.7 innings respectively. The Indians have had 3-complete games which has kept their relievers fresh. While Ryan Madson has appeared in 11 games, that is the 15th highest of any reliever for the number of appearances. For reliever innings, Matt Grace leads the Nationals in most innings at 10 2/3, and he ranks only the 41st for most relief innings. The issue seems more to usage and statistical match-ups rather than over-use except for the case of Ryan Madson.

The Nationals will bolster the bullpen by activating Austin Adams and sending Anthony Rendon to the DL. By MLB rules, Rendon will have to sit at least 7 days as the 10-day DL can only be backdated for 3 days. At this point, Rendon probably needed to fully rest the bruised toe and then go can go on a rehab assignment to face live pitching and get his timing back. Manager Dave Martinez practically guaranteed that Rendon would return this weekend. There were days the Nationals played with Goodwin and Rendon on the bench with neither available which put the Nationals at a severe disadvantage with a 3-man bench. Going forward, the Nationals will employ an 8-man bullpen and a 4-man bench.

Tonight’s starters will be Jeremy Hellickson for the Nats and left-handed Alex Wood for the Dodgers. This is the 3rd lefty the Nationals have faced in this Dodgers series.

With Rendon going to the DL, the Nationals will be without Rendon, Adam Eaton, Daniel Murphy and Brian Goodwin for over half this season-to-date. Their combined absences is really taking its toll on this team that just cannot make up for their production.
